Detailed Overview

The Pharmacist provides distribution pharmacy services by performing duties such as interpreting medication orders/prescriptions, assessing prescriptions for therapeutic suitability, and ensuring that medications are efficiently and accurately dispensed and/or compounded and labelled. Communicates with physicians, patients, and/or other health care team members for prescription clarification and problem resolution. Provides instructions to others on proper use/administration, storage and/or disposal, and possible side effects of prescribed and self-selected medications. Participates in the collection of data for medication use evaluation projects, implementation of dispensary-based medication safety initiatives, quality control activities, contributes to internal publications, and participates in clinical drug trials in accordance with established standards and procedures.

Additionally, the Pharmacist functions as a Clinical Pharmacist responsible for ensuring select patient drug-related problems are resolved. Participates in nursing ward rounds and/or program team meetings and documents patient-specific therapeutic plans.


Responsibilities

  1. Interprets medication orders/prescriptions and dispenses medications using a computerized medication information system in accordance with legal, professional, and departmental policies, procedures, and standards.
  2. Assesses prescriptions for therapeutic suitability by referring to standardized references (primary drug information texts), interpreting laboratory data, and/or reviewing patient-specific demographics.
  3. Reviews patient profiles for any patient allergies, potential drug interactions, therapeutic duplications, or contraindications. Withholds medications until safety concerns are resolved.
  4. Communicates with physicians, patients, and/or other health care team members for prescription clarification and problem resolution. Documents the outcome of the interaction with the prescriber.
  5. Provides instructions to others on proper use/administration, storage and/or disposal, possible side effects of prescribed and self-selected medications, etc. Communicates verbally and in writing with physicians, nurses, and other professionals and provides drug information using appropriate reference material.
  6. Participates in obtaining medication history from select patients and verifies any allergy information and assists with medication reconciliation process.
  7. Ensures that medications are efficiently and accurately dispensed and/or compounded and labelled, and that dispensing records are completed.
  8. Provides medication counselling regarding drug therapy to patients and/or their families, as required. Provides allergy assessment and discharge counselling for appropriate patients. Documents patient interactions in the patient health care record in a standardized format.
  9. Reviews patient screening reports or targeted drug lists and identifies potential drug-related problems based on available laboratory data.
  10. Provides basic pharmacokinetic interpretations on patients receiving targeted drugs (e.g., aminoglycoside, warfarin, and vancomycin).
  11. Participates in the collection of data for medication use evaluation projects and documents the required information. Assists in maintaining adequate inventories, notes shortages, requisitions drugs and/or supplies, and monitors expiry dates, reports procedural errors, and participates in quality improvement activities.
  12. Participates in dispensary-based implementation of medication safety initiatives and quality control activities in accordance with established standards and procedures.
  13. Maintains records for narcotic and controlled drugs, special access program drugs, and departmental statistics in accordance with legal, professional, and departmental standards, policies, and procedures.
  14. Participates in the orientation of pharmacy students, residents, technicians, assistants, and new staff members by demonstrating dispensary-related functions, procedures, techniques, and department equipment and by providing verbal guidance and input regarding progress, as assigned.
  15. Contributes to internal publications and participates in clinical drug trials by dispensing medications and completing associated documentation. Reviews cases of reported drug adverse reactions and completes necessary documentation.
  16. Participates in staff meetings, committees, and other programs as required; identifies opportunities to improve processes and/or procedures to enable safe and efficient operations and refers to supervisor and/or others.
  17. Functions as a clinical pharmacist responsible for ensuring select patient drug-related problems are resolved. Participates in ward rounds and/or program team meetings and documents patient-specific therapeutic plans.
  18. Performs other related duties as assigned.

About Fraser Health

Fraser Health is the heart of health care for over two million people in Metro Vancouver and the Fraser Valley in British Columbia, Canada, on the traditional, ancestral, and unceded lands of the Coast Salish and Nlaka’pamux Nations and is home to 32 First Nations within the Fraser Salish region.

People - those we care for and those who care for them - are at the heart of everything we do. Our hospital and community-based services are delivered by a team of 48,000+ staff, medical staff, and volunteers.
